Nestled in the heart of Italy's bustling Lombardy region, there's a small town with a big personality — Bernate Ticino. While it may not appear on your typical travel bucket list like Milan or Florence, it certainly should. This quaint Italian parish sits on the banks of the Naviglio Grande canal, a historic waterway that brings both beauty and history to the region. Founded in the Middle Ages, Bernate Ticino offers a unique glimpse into the past, away from the hustle and bustle of big cities, yet close enough to dip a toe in urban life when desired.

One such architectural gem is the beautiful Parochial Church of Saint George. This stunning structure steals the spotlight in the town square, its bell tower reaching skywards in classic Renaissance style. Inside, the frescoes paint the story of a town that prides itself on its artistic heritage. Take a moment to sit on one of the wooden pews and imagine the generations of villagers before you, united by shared beliefs and a love for their hometown.

The Naviglio Grande canal is perhaps the town's most significant feature. It's a reminder of Bernate Ticino’s historical role as a prominent trade route during the era of the Visconti and the Sforzas. Today, it serves more as a scenic walking route rather than a gateway for commerce. Long paths run alongside the canal, offering perfect trails for those who enjoy a good cycle or walk amidst lush greenery and water reflections.
